The Minnesota Vikings face a pivotal decision this offseason regarding quarterback Sam Darnold’s future with the franchise.

The conversation gained new momentum when star receiver Justin Jefferson recently expressed his desire for Darnold to stay, and now Hall of Fame wide receiver Cris Carter has joined the chorus of voices weighing in on the quarterback’s fate.

Carter’s perspective, however, comes with an interesting twist.

Rather than simply advocating for Darnold’s return, he suggests a strategic approach that aligns with recent reports about the Vikings’ stance on using their franchise tag.

During his appearance on the Up & Adams Show with Kay Adams, Carter laid out his reasoning for keeping Darnold in Minnesota.

“You franchise him because having a quarterback like Sam (Darnold) and the year he had, he will always be a commodity. You eventually will be able to trade him.”

This viewpoint resonates with many analysts who see value in maintaining the current quarterback situation.

Carter emphasizes that retaining both quarterbacks would be the prudent move, particularly given Darnold’s successful adaptation to their system.

His logic centers on the enduring value of experienced quarterbacks who’ve shown they can produce results – even if Darnold doesn’t secure the starting role, he’d remain a valuable trade asset.

The Vikings’ quarterback conundrum runs deeper than surface level.

McCarthy’s injury last season opened the door for Darnold’s unexpected emergence in 2024, where he led the team to an impressive 13-4 record under head coach Kevin O’Connell.

This success has attracted attention from multiple NFL teams, intensifying discussions about his future.

Yet opinions remain divided. While some attribute Darnold’s success primarily to O’Connell’s offensive system, others see it as proof he’s developed into a legitimate franchise quarterback.
